2013 is the Year of Natural Scotland and there are some interesting events in the planning. 

Spring Fling , which is the our Dumfries and Galloway wide showcase for artists living and working in the area is from 23 to 25 May 2013. 

The annual wildlife fortnight is scheduled for 29 March to 14 April.
